Transaction 338ff9dedb7c76df2deefaa31d95da85d5afa226ae15e86c533766f4a5508a59

1 Input
2 Outputs
  • 338ff9dedb7c76df2deefaa31d95da85d5afa226ae15e86c533766f4a5508a59:0
  • value  354427959
    address  31w3iWUN5EMJMW2YRCc5m4RFqm3zN61xK2
  • 338ff9dedb7c76df2deefaa31d95da85d5afa226ae15e86c533766f4a5508a59:1
  • value  300460000
    address  1FeKVDEvVXJX5FTcUDbdLc24TY4snQZ1sN